CMI Group, headquartered near Liège in Belgium, is knowned for its combinaison of experience in Engineering and Maintenance in Defence, Energy and Industry sectors. Since the seventies, CMI-Defence has specialized in weapon systems for Light and Medium Armoured Vehicles. CMI Defence is recognized as the world leader in 90mm caliber gun systems, two of which are the COCKERILL MK3M-A1 and CSE90 turret and the COCKERILL Mk8 90mm gun and LCTS turret. CMI has traditionally been known for this ability to develop weapons system with distinctive performances, high accuracy and superior firepower. As both an integrator and designer of weapon systems, CMI Defence equips armoured vehicle with dedicated firepower systems. CMI’s state-of-the-art systems are designed to ensure reliability and longevity. They have been carefully developed to address the current and anticipated threats that modern armed forces are facing and to integrate future innovations and upgrades. These include new ammunition, new technological developments and new safety systems. CMI's weapon system encompass the ultimate in survivability, safety and ergonomics to preserve the well being and the integrity of the crew and to guarantee the best possible level of protection for both commander and gunner. CMI Defence is world leader for design and development of 30 - 120 mm weapon systems for light/medium weight AFVs, turret systems integration and refurbishment and upgrading of AFVs.

Associated to the project of development of a heavy helicopter fulfilling the requirements of NATO, Russia proposed to NATO the bigger helicopter of the world, the MI-26 (NATO code: Halo), announced Mikhaïl Korotkevitch, chairman of Helicopter Factory of Moscow, to the journalists. “The design of a powerful helicopter is often evoked by NATO, and the Member States of Alliance express an important interest for our heavy helicopters”, it declared. Work of the research department Mil, the MI-26T is currently in time of a modernization. According to M.Korotkevitch, this helicopter answers 100% with the requirements formulated by Atlantic Alliance. “The tests are showed that the Mi-26T satisfied with all the requirements emitted towards the transport cargo of NATO. There is not any doubt that the future will belong to this aircraft and its supplier, and the Rostov factory of helicopters. Multi-purpose helicopter with broad fuselage, the Mi-26T is intended for the cargo transport of and weapons of important size.
